Butadiene Polymerization Catalyzed by Polynuclear Nd-Al Bimetallic Complex V. Effect of Methylaluminoxane
Abstract:
The effect of methylaluminoxane(MAO) on butadiene polymerization catalyzed by polynuclear Nd-Al bimetallic complex has been examined. Compared with alkylaluminium MAO could improve the activity of the catalyst system to a higher extent even at n(Al)/n(Nd) 5~20 mol/mol. The chain transfer seems to be lower by using MAO than that by using alkylaluminium.
